Abstract(in English) A 12-lead electrocardiogram (ECG) was invented more than 100 years ago, and they are still used as an essential tool to detect early heart disease. However, the number of electrodes in the 12-lead ECG is limited to nine. In addition, it is not easy to model the electric potential simply due to the inhomogeneity of the human body, which causes a notable estimation error on source localization. In this study, we propose a localization method for cardiac source with 12-lead ECG via sparse reconstruction. The lead field matrix was constructed by solving a forward problem for an inhomogeneous human model based on the scalar-potential finite-difference method. The cardiac source was estimated, as an inverse problem, by the orthogonal matching pursuit method. From the computational results, the average localization error of the electric dipole sources in the heart was 12.6 mm, and the average direction error was 9.9°, which is comparable to or somewhat better than those in previous studies.
